Transaction e49e649254f64a661a3dbcb41633794be3fb49a666990d4de783789f68c49156
1 Input
1 Output
-
e49e649254f64a661a3dbcb41633794be3fb49a666990d4de783789f68c49156:0
- value
- 3332928
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03c59820eb90081e994a5134c76bf7e44365dae9 OP_EQUAL
- address
- 322xfD3voPruqEqxAeL6dittyWS8RnYmFz